Default 3pg performance mods

I am thanking about doing the mods to the top end of my 3pg motor that theGDFP did for Bikertrash00. Has any one else done this to there motor and how was the performance after? I am thinking of actuality going in and porting the cylinder so I would not have to build the spacer and cut the top of the cylinder. Also putting the 88 carb on it and changing the ing. timing. Any suggestions?

Yeah BE CAREFUL! Porting any motor, 4 stroke or 2 stroke, can add performance, but if done incorrectly can reduce performance WAY more than you would think. I do think (don't "know" but do believe) that 2 strokes are even more sensitive to porting than 4 strokes. So when in doubt, do less.
Good luck, when done right I know it can make you very happy! When done wrong, you need to buy a new cylinder, so not the end of the world, but still!

I have done 2 strokes before the port timing is what makes the difference if I do port the motor will start with the degree wheel . It is just like changing the cam in a 4 stroke . Am looking for some suggestions on port timing.
